Fundamental Site Safety Signage for a Secure Work Environment

A safe and secure work environment is paramount for any construction or industrial location. One crucial aspect of achieving this goal is through the strategic utilization of clear and explicit safety signage. That signs serve as a constant reminder to workers about potential hazards and mandatory safety procedures.

  • Providing clear caution signs in sections where possible risks exist is essential. Examples include signs for collapsing objects, live machinery, and restricted spaces.
  • Additionally, directional indicators are crucial to lead workers to first-aid equipment. Clearly labeled exits and assembly points should also be clearly displayed.
  • Periodically inspect and service safety signs to ensure their legibility. Replace any damaged or faded signs immediately to prevent misunderstandings and potential incidents.

By implementing a comprehensive safety signage program, you can create a work environment that is protected for all. Remember, effective communication through clear and concise signage is essential to encouraging a strong safety atmosphere.

Precise & Succinct: Communicating Safety on Construction Sites

Safety on work sites is paramount. To ensure a secure environment for everyone, clear and concise communication is essential. Whether it's communicating safety procedures, highlighting potential hazards, or offering instructions, every message must be intelligible. Use plain language and avoid jargon. Promote open communication by building a culture where workers feel comfortable requesting questions and reporting potential safety concerns.

  • Establish regular toolbox talks to review safety protocols and address any concerns.
  • Employ visual aids like signs, posters, and diagrams to reinforce key safety messages.
  • Perform site inspections regularly to identify potential hazards and ensure compliance with safety regulations.

Safeguarding Construction Workers: Crucial Role of Clear Site Signage

On any construction site, safety is paramount. One often overlooked yet crucial aspect of maintaining a safe work environment is the use of effective signage. Signs act as a vital communication tool, conveying important information to workers, visitors, and the general public.

  • Well-maintained signs ensure that everyone on the site is aware of the potential risks and their responsibilities.
  • Signs can specifically label work zones, hazardous areas, and emergency exits, promoting a more efficient work environment.
  • Complying with industry safety standards through appropriate signage demonstrates a dedication to worker well-being and legal compliance.

Investing in durable signs that can withstand the rigors of a construction site is a strategic decision. Regular maintenance are also essential to ensure that signage remains clear and effectively serves its purpose.
